165 gr Critical Defense is what my most finicky .40 likes, so all of my other .40's like it, too, so that's what I use.
 
My agency issues Speer Gold Dots. Can't say I've ever connected one with anything other than paper or dirt, but they do go *bang* and fly straight.
 
Personally I like Critical Duty more than Critical Defense. Yeah, might not expand that much, but it does expand and it keeps it doesn't shed weight where the Critical Defense loses petals all the time.

But Critical Defense is meant for short (3 to 4 inch) barrels.
